Sankey charts are a type of flow diagram that visually represents the flow of items between different categories. They are characterized by their branch-like appearance and the proportional width of each branch, which indicates the volume of flow. This type of chart provides clear insights into the sources and destinations of the flow, making it a valuable tool in various fields such as economics, science, and business analysis.

In this comprehensive guide, we delve into the world of Sankey charts, exploring different types of Sankey charts, their construction, and best practices for creating effective visualizations.

Construction of a Sankey Chart

To create an effective Sankey chart, the following components are essential:

1. **Nodes**: Representing the sources, final destinations, or intermediate points in the flow system.
2. **Edges**: These are the lines connecting the nodes, indicating the connection and the amount of flow between them.
3. **Weights**: Adjust the width of the edges to represent the magnitude of the flow, ensuring the visual proportions accurately reflect the data.
4. **Labels**: Adding descriptive labels to nodes and edges allows for better interpretation of the data.

Best Practices for Effective Visualizations

1. **Data Normalization**: To ensure that the chart accurately reflects the data, normalize the flow volumes so that each set of flows is comparable.
2. **Highlighting Important Flows**: Use color coding or contrasting edges to draw attention to significant flow paths.
3. **Color Consistency**: Maintain consistent color usage across related flows or categories to enhance legibility and understandability of the chart.
4. **Interactive Elements**: Incorporate interactive features such as tooltips, zoom functions, and filters to deepen user engagement and improve data understanding.
5. **Legends and Legends**: Include clear legends and labels to explain the meaning of different colors and symbols used in the chart.
